Naming a female kitten is an exciting and meaningful task for any cat owner. The name you choose can reflect her personality, appearance, or even your personal preferences. Here are some detailed guidelines and reviews to help you make the perfect choice.
Firstly, consider the kitten's physical traits. Names inspired by her fur color, pattern, or eye color can be both descriptive and endearing. For example, a kitten with striking blue eyes might be named "Sapphire" or "Skye." A kitten with a distinctive white patch on her fur could be called "Daisy" or "Snowflake." These names not only highlight her unique features but also add a touch of elegance.
Next, think about her personality. Is she energetic and playful? Names like "Zippy," "Dash," or "Pippin" could suit her well. If she is more laid-back and affectionate, consider names like "Luna," "Mellow," or "Serenity." Observing her behavior and temperament can provide valuable insights into the type of name that would best fit her.
Another approach is to draw inspiration from popular culture, literature, or mythology. Names from classic stories, movies, or folklore can add a layer of depth and intrigue. For instance, "Bella" from the Twilight series, "Arya" from Game of Thrones, or "Freya" from Norse mythology are all excellent choices. These names carry rich histories and can make your kitten stand out.
Additionally, consider the sound and ease of pronunciation of the name. A name that is easy to call and pleasant to hear can enhance your bond with your kitten. Short, one-syllable names like "Mia," "Luna," or "Daisy" are often popular choices. However, longer names with a melodic quality, such as "Melody," "Aurora," or "Isolde," can also be charming.
It is also worth considering names that have a positive or uplifting meaning. For example, "Hope" signifies optimism, "Grace" conveys elegance, and "Joy" brings happiness. Choosing a name with a positive connotation can add a sense of warmth and positivity to your relationship with your kitten.
Lastly, involve your family or friends in the naming process. Sometimes, a fresh perspective can lead to a name that you might not have considered. Discussing potential names with loved ones can also make the process more enjoyable and memorable. Ultimately, the best name for your female kitten is one that feels right to you and resonates with her unique qualities.
